Excellent chemical resistance: Without sacrificing the flexibility, glass-like clarity and outstanding bend radius for which Tygon® tubing is known, Tygon® inert tubing can handle many applications where flexible tubing of the past could not be used. Its FEP inner liner provides the ultimate in chemical resistance and can accommodate a wide variety of fluids from corrosives to MEK-based solvents. The inert liner limits potential of fluid contamination during transfer. Tygon® inert tubing will not impart odor or taste, making it well-suited for food and beverage use. Tygon® inert tubing combines all the benefits of Tygon® with the inertness of a fluoropolymer, providing superior performance in many applications and industries.

Material : Tygon
Length : 50'
Series : SE-200
Color : Clear
Diameter : 0.1875 ID x 0.3125" OD
Wall Thickness : 0.0625"
Minimum Blend Radius : 1.5"
Maximum Working Pressure : 75 psi at 73°F, 38 psi at 160°F
Durometer Hardness : 67 (Shore A), 15 sec
Tensile Strength : 2000 psi
Ultimate Elongation : 350%
Specific Gravity : 1.45
Maximum Operating Temperature : 170°F
Tensile Stress : 650 psi at 100% and 1450 psi at 300%
Tensile Set : 76%
